Cuttack: Bazaar Kolkata shopping mall at CDA Sector 7 in Odisha’s Cuttack city was sealed by the enforcement team of the city’s municipal corporation on Thursday for allegedly flouting building norms.
According to sources, Cuttack Municipal Corporation (CMC) conducted a raid over traffic congestion concerns due to illegal parking at the mall and later sealed the shopping mall for illegal parking and other irregularities in the construction of the building.
Management of the complex was running the mall while paying holding tax for a godown, the sources added.
“The parking space was unauthorised as the area meant for the purpose is being used for running the mall. There were some unauthorised constructions at the complex as well,” CMC deputy commissioner Ajay Mohanty told media persons.
The management was giving holding tax for a godown while running an entire shopping complex, he said, adding that it will remain closed until the management furnishes the required documents.
